Crimson Desert PC system requirements: Minimum requierments and recommended specs Crimson Desert developer Pearl Abyss has provided a rough guideline to what specs you’ll need to run the game on each graphics preset. Crimson Desert minimum specs The minimum requirements to run Crimson Desert on PC will allow for a resolution of 1080p (upscaled from 900p) running at 30 fps: GPU: AMD Radeon RX 5500 XT / Nvidia GeForce GTX 1060 CPU: AMD Ryzen 5 2600X / Intel i5-8500 RAM: 16GB OS: Windows 10 64-bit 22H2 or newer Storage: 150GB SSD DirectX: DirectX 12 Want to see this content? In 2023, Elyon Badger shared on TikTok that by doing the same math as when minimum wage was instituted, it should be $52 an hour by now. Three years later, not much has changed. We tend to think of minimum wage jobs as being for teenagers and the uneducated, a mindset that makes it easy to forget what it was intended to do when it was first implemented: provide a livable wage for everyone, no matter what kind of work they do.  That, of course, is not at all how it’s shaken out in the decades since. Though many states set their own standards, the federal minimum wage is a laughable $7.25 an hour and has been since 2009. Nobody can seriously argue that such a rate is reasonable, especially since what the math says the minimum wage should be is downright shocking. But economist Geoffrey Williams, director of Williams Business Consultancy, said the claim that expatriates are taking jobs from locals is not true. “Firstly, there are too few expatriates to make that claim meaningful. Secondly, it is already costly to pay for visas, so they are not competitive in a cost sense,” he wrote in a post on LinkedIn. “Thirdly, expatriates are employed for very specific reasons based on experience and expertise. This will not change.” The Malaysian Immigration Department issued 180,812 EPs – including new applications and renewals – in 2025, up from 160,380 passes in 2024. Malaysia had 17.06 million employed people in October 2025. Williams told CNA it is not so much the comparison to regional countries that counts, but the way it has been communicated – “that Malaysia does not want expats somehow”. These changes have sparked fears among the expatriate community of being forced to leave once their contracts end, despite past contributions to local jobs and the economy.
